5611. hóraios

hóraios: seasonable, timely
Original Word: ὡραῖος, αία, αῖον
Part of Speech: Adjective
Transliteration: hóraios
Phonetic Spelling: (ho-rah'-yos)
Short Definition: fair, beautiful
Definition: fair, beautiful, blooming.

5611 hōraíos (from 5610 /hṓra, "an hour, the time of fulfillment") – properly, a particular hour (a "season" of time); (figuratively) beautiful in timing, hence fruitful because fully developed (prepared, as in Ro 10:15).

beautiful.

From hora; belonging to the right hour or season (timely), i.e. (by implication) flourishing (beauteous (figuratively)) -- beautiful.
